Transaction ec62b7e792c60f6592423b4e67e8ca5d20b699d00185cb43735a32243ffd6283
1 Input
2 Outputs
- ec62b7e792c60f6592423b4e67e8ca5d20b699d00185cb43735a32243ffd6283:0
- ec62b7e792c60f6592423b4e67e8ca5d20b699d00185cb43735a32243ffd6283:1
value 312118
address 1DwL9AwpL9TmnnyhRW4V7uYT6etW5LnGED
value 6188031148
address 16JDrCRNzJXVBrdTvLFrmQ7riDnFTKdMqK